In this webinar we discuss the role of cities in the energy transition. Cities are often at the forefront of combatting climate change and are key players in the transition to a sustainable and renewable energy future. Our featured guest speaker, Lotte Schlegel, Executive Director of the Institute for Market Transformation, shares insights on how cities can lead the way in this important effort.
Cities have a critical role to play in the energy transition economy. By focusing on their primary asset, buildings, they can drive economic growth, reduce pollution, and tackle climate change. In this webinar, Lotte Schlegel will discuss innovative and pragmatic approaches that cities can take to lead the energy transition.
As Executive Director of the Institute for Market Transformation, Lotte Schlegel is an expert in improving the built environment to save money and reduce emissions. She shares her insights on the challenges and opportunities facing cities in the energy transition, and discuss how policy-driven and community-minded approaches can drive progress.
